Re: Mounts - one last time
Joel Alpers writes:
>for example, I'm told that the Chicago Stereo Camera Club
>requires_ that slides mounted for competition be in aluminum/glass.
The CSCC has 3 classes of competition, B, A and AA. Cardboard, including
commercially mounted (e.g., Kodalux), is allowed in the introductory
classification B, although most are entered in glass. Glass-mounted slides
are "required" in the other 2 classes, although RBT mounts are also
fine. The idea is to encourage higher quality slides having precision
mounting, and the precision masks are considered superior to cardboard,
which can warp, etc. The glass offers dust and thermal protection to
the chips as well.
These rules date back to the founding of the club in the 1950's, which
is why the RBT mounts are not specifically addressed but allowed.
